How to find the Maximum of Two Numbers in Perl ?

Answer

To find the maximum of two numbers in Perl, you can use the max function from the List::Util module.



✐ Examples

1 Maximum of Two Numbers

In this example,

  1. We use the use List::Util qw(max); statement to import the max function.
  2. We declare two variables $a and $b and assign values to them.
  3. We use the max function to find the maximum of $a and $b.
  4. We print the maximum value.

Perl Program

# Maximum of Two Numbers
use strict;
use warnings;
use List::Util qw(max);

my $a = 10;
my $b = 15;
my $max_value = max($a, $b);

print "Maximum of $a and $b is: $max_value\n";

Output

Maximum of 10 and 15 is: 15
